Understanding Your Risk Exposure
Playing online slot games involves financial risk that every player should understand before depositing money. The house always maintains a mathematical edge, meaning the odds favor the casino over time. This doesn’t mean you’ll lose every session, but understanding volatility helps you manage expectations. High-volatility slots pay out larger sums less frequently, while low-volatility games offer smaller wins more often. Knowing which type suits your risk tolerance is essential for responsible play.
Setting Realistic Betting Limits
Establishing firm betting limits is your first line of defense against excessive losses. Decide how much money you can afford to lose without affecting your essential expenses—rent, food, utilities, and savings. Never gamble with money borrowed from credit cards or loans. Beyond deposit limits, establish session time limits. Extended play sessions increase the risk of poor decision-making and chasing losses. Take regular breaks to maintain perspective and avoid emotional gambling. Some players find it helpful to use an alarm or timer to remind themselves when their session should end.
Choosing Licensed and Regulated Platforms
The legal status of your gaming platform directly impacts your financial security and consumer protection. Only play on websites licensed by recognized gambling authorities in reputable jurisdictions. Legitimate operators display their licensing information prominently and undergo regular audits to ensure fair gameplay. These licenses protect you from fraud, unfair odds, and payment disputes.
Before signing up, research the platform’s reputation through independent review sites and player forums. Check for SSL encryption on the website, which protects your personal and financial information. Verify that the random number generator is independently tested and certified. Licensed operators also offer responsible gambling tools, including self-exclusion options and access to problem gambling resources.
Managing Your Psychology and Habits
Emotional control separates casual players from those who develop problematic gambling habits. Never play slots when you’re stressed, angry, or depressed, as negative emotions cloud judgment. The temptation to chase losses—playing longer to recover money—is particularly dangerous. Accept that some sessions will end in losses; this is part of the game’s nature.
